Umugore wahoze mu nama y'ubutegetsi ya kompanyi OpenAI yasobanuye uko umubano we w'ibanga na Elon Musk wavuyemo kumuha impano y'intanga bakabyarana abana bane.
Shivon Zilis yamaze amasaha atanga ubuhamya mu rukiko rw'i Oakland muri California ku wa gatatu mu kirego kiri mu rukiko hagati ya Elon Musk na Sam Altman nyiri kompanyi izwi cyane ya 'Artificial Intelligence' yitwa OpenAI.
Musk yareze yifuza ko OpenAI yongera kuba kompanyi itagamije inyungu, nk'uko yatangiye imeze. Elon Musk, umuntu wa mbere ukize cyane ku isi, ari mu bashinze OpenAI mu 2015.
Musk arasaba urukiko gutegeka ko OpenAI imuha inyungu ya miliyari 150$ ashinja abayikuriye guhindura iyi kompanyi yafatanyije gushinga ikaba kompanyi igamije inyungu ariko we ntahabwe inyungu, mu gihe avuga ko yayitanzemo miliyoni nyinshi z'amadorari igihe yari ikiri kompanyi idaharanira inyungu.
Icyatumye Shivon ahamgazwa mu rukiko ni uburyo yagiranye na Musk ibiganiro bitaziguye mu ntangiriro mu gihe OpenAI yahindukaga ikaba kompanyi igamije inyungu, ariko kandi n'uburyo yamukoreraga ndetse akanaba umujyanama wa OpenAI.
Avuga uburyo mu 2020 Elon Musk yamuhaye intanga, Shivon yagize ati: "Nari nkeneye rwose kuba umubyeyi kandi Elon yifuje kumfasha icyo gihe, nanjye ndemera.
"Icyo gihe yashishikarizaga buri wese umwegereye kugira abana maze abona ko njye ntabo mfite. Nuko anyemere kumpa impano [y'intanga]."
Shivon Zilis yamaze imyaka 15 akora muri Silicon Valley ahantu haba ibyicaro bya kompanyi zikomeye mu ikoranabuhanga muri Amerika, ndetse yabaye mu myanya yo hejuru muri kompanyi Tesla na Neuralink za Musk.
Mu 2016 yagiye muri OpenAI nk'umujyanama, hashize igihe gito ishinzwe, umwanya avuga ko ari wo watumye ahura bwa mbere na Elon Musk.
Uhereye ku mirimo yagize muri kompanyi za Musk na OpenAI, amaherezo Shivon yabaye umukuru wa OpenAI kuva mu 2020 kugeza mu 2023.
Ubu ni umutangabuhamya w'ingenzi muri ruriya rubanza ruhanganishije abahoze bamukuriye.
Abunganira OpenAI bavuga ko Shivon yahaga Musk amakuru ya OpenAI nyuma y'uko uyu mukire ayivuyemo mu 2018.
Shivon yavuze ko yakoze urukundo "inshuro imwe" na Musk mu myaka irenga icumi ishize ariko ko mu 2020 igihe yamuhaga impano y'intanga zavuyemo abana be batari bagikundana.
Yasobanuye ko yari ahanganye n'ibibazo bitandukanye by'amagara byatumye ahindura imigambi ye yo gushaka umugabo no kubyara abana mu buryo busanzwe bw'urukundo.
Yasobanuye ko we na Musk bari barumvikanye ko iby'iyo mpano y'intanga n'abana babo "bizaba ibanga" hagati yabo, ndetse ko bitari ngombwa ko Musk aba umubyeyi uri mu buzima bw'abo bana.
Uyu munsi, Musk ni umugabo ugira uruhare mu buzima bw'abo bana bane afitanye na Shivon, nk'uko uyu mugore yabivuze, yavuze ko Musk amarana na bo amasaha runaka mu cyumweru nk'umuryango.
Shivon yasobanuye ko amasezerano y'ibanga yagiranye na Musk ari yo yatumye adasobanurira umukuru wa OpenAI witwa Sam Altman ko impanga yabyaye mu 2021 ari iza Musk.
Avuga ko yabibwiye Altman mu mwaka wakurikiyeho, abonye ko hari inkuru y'ikinyamakuru Business Insider yari igiye gusohoka yemeza ko Musk ari we se w'abo bana.
Nubwo OpenAI yari ifitanye ibibazo bikomeye na Musk, Shivon yavuze ko Altman na perezida wa AI witwa Greg Brockman bifuje gukomeza gukorana n'uyu mugore nk'umwe mu bagize inama y'ubutegetsi.
Altman yabwiye urukiko ko nyuma y'uko Musk agiye "Twakomeje kwizera [Shivon] ko azabasha guturisha amakimbirane na Musk"
Mu 2023 Shivon yavuye mu nama y'ubutegetsi ya OpenAI ubwo Musk yatangizaga xAI, kompanyi ya AI ikora 'chatbot' ihanganye bikomeye ku isoko na ChatGPT ya OpenAI.
Urukiko rwabonye inyandiko na emails zivuga ko Musk yashakaga kugenzura byuzuye OpenAI ndetse yigeze gusaba ko yaba ishami rya Tesla.
Amaherezo, Altman, Brockman baje kunanirwa kumvikana na Musk ku mikoranire, ahanini kuko banganga ko uyu muherwe "agenzura byuzuye" akazi ka OpenAI, nk'uko biri muri email Shivon yeretse urukiko.
